Share: Title:Baba fm and baba tv live in idudi mu activations of ekituda Duration: 1:54 Plays: 1.3K views Published: 2 years ago Download MP3 Download MP4 Simillar Videos ▶️ 1:58 Mugabe Sworn In As Zimbabwe President 1.3K views • 11 years ago ▶️ 1:43 Mugabe Says Zimbabwe Elections Free And Fair 1.3K views • 11 years ago ▶️ 0:54 Mugabe Threatens 400 Uk Companies If Wins Next Election 1.3K views • 9 years ago ▶️ 0:42 Zimbabwean Government Welcomes The Au Mugabe Appointment 1.3K views • 10 years ago ▶️ 0:59 Mugabe Says World Must Accept His Presidency 1.3K views • 16 years ago